Jacob Wilson –
odds and ends like chapstick, diaper cream and a pacifier fit in …
I use this insert in my diaper bag. I bought a cute duffel bag from target and bought this insert to help compartmentalize all babies items. It fits 3-4 diapers and apace of wipes in the large compartment on the end, I keep my wallet in one of the side compartments, a water bottle across from it babies rolled up extra clothes fit in another pocket, odds and ends like chapstick, diaper cream and a pacifier fit in another pocket, and I keep a notebook and pens in the last one. My one complaint of this bag is that the walls of the compartments are not attached to the bottom of the insert, so the things you put in it may slide to the bottom and slip to another compartment if they’re small. I frequently fish for pens or breath mints at the bottom. It was a bit smaller than the bag I put it in, so it slides around inside my bag, but that is my own problem and not indicative of the insert as a whole. I love this product because it lets me carry a cute bag that is still functional.
Mini Long Family –
Perfect for diaper bags!
I’ve been eyeing some $200+ diaper bags from a company that emphasizes the removable organizer and aesthetic appeal of a normal purse versus a traditional diaper bag; however, even just their organizer alone is $50+ and I just didn’t feel like biting the bullet. I searched a little bit and found this bag divider for a fraction of the cost for the aforementioned diaper bag. Thought I’d take a risk and I’m so glad I did.This divider fits perfectly in a Patagonia lightweight travel tote that both my boyfriend and I use as a diaper bag. When I feel like carrying a normal bag bag, I can easily switch it to my large Longchamp Le Pliage tote. I like how it provides structure for both bags.As for what fits in it, our biggest items would have to be a Ju-Ju-Be quick wristlet, OXO tot-on-the-go wipes dispenser, and Munchkin formula dispenser. All fit with no problem in the compartments of this bag insert. My only gripe is that the dividers don’t extend all the way down so sometimes small items can slip around. I try to remedy this problem by grouping smaller items into clear zip bags.I do regret getting the black colored insert though as both bags that we use the insert with are black. A colored insert would probably make things easier to spot. I’ve never had any problems with smells although initially the insert did have that funky manufactured smell. I simply left it to air outside on the balcony for a day and have had no further problems, haven’t bothered to wash or Febreeze it.
